Alice Wilcox 1926 - 2003

Alice Wilcox was born on December 19, 1926, and died at age 76 years old on April 22, 2003. Alice Wilcox was buried at Calverton National Cemetery Section 16 Site 5661 210 Princeton Boulevard - Rt 25, in Calverton, Ny. In 1926, in the year that Alice Wilcox was born, on November 15th, NBC was founded. It was the U.S.'s first major broadcast network. Ownership of the network was split between RCA (a majority partner at 50%), its founding corporate parent General Electric (which owned 30%), and Westinghouse (which owned the remaining 20%).

In 1939, at the age of only 13 years old, Alice was alive when on the 1st of September, Nazi Germany invaded Poland. On September 17th, the Soviet Union invaded Poland as well. Poland expected help from France and the United Kingdom, since they had a pact with both. But no help came. By October 6th, the Soviet Union and Nazi Germany held full control of the previously Polish lands. Eventually, the invasion of Poland lead to World War II.
